About Valpro Injection 5 ml

Valpro Injection 5 ml is a specialised injection used to treat various types of seizures and epilepsy in patients who cannot take medicines by mouth. It works by calming overactive nerve signals in the brain to help control and prevent sudden seizure episodes. This medicine is typically injected in hospital or clinical settings under professional supervision to ensure safety and effectiveness.

Because this medicine is given directly into a vein, a healthcare professional will manage your treatment schedule to ensure you receive consistent and timely doses. While receiving this therapy, maintaining a regular sleep schedule and avoiding extreme stress can support your recovery. It is also helpful to stay well-hydrated and follow any specific dietary plans recommended by your healthcare team.

Some people may experience mild side effects like dizziness, sleepiness, or mild nausea after receiving an injection. However, you must tell your healthcare provider immediately if you notice serious symptoms such as severe stomach pain, unusual bruising, or yellowing of your eyes and skin.

Before receiving Valpro Injection 5 ml, tell your doctor if you have a history of liver problems, kidney disease, or mitochondrial disorders. Do not take this medicine if you have active liver disease or a family history of severe liver damage. It is also crucial to tell your doctor if you are pregnant or planning to become pregnant, as this medicine can cause harm to an unborn baby.

This medicine can interact with other seizure medications, blood thinners, and alcohol, which may increase your risk of severe sleepiness or bleeding. Women who are pregnant or breastfeeding, as well as elderly individuals, should discuss the risks and benefits thoroughly with their doctor before receiving this treatment.

Uses of Valpro Injection 5 ml

Your doctor may prescribe Valpro Injection 5 ml to help manage the following conditions:

  • Status epilepticus: It helps quickly control rapid, continuous seizure activity when immediate emergency treatment is critical.
  • Epilepsy and various seizure types: It is used to control generalised, partial, or other complex seizures when oral medication is temporarily not possible.
  • Prevention of seizures after surgery or trauma: It helps prevent brain seizure activity following brain surgery or head injuries.

How Valpro Injection 5 ml Works

Valpro Injection 5 ml contains sodium valproate. Sodium valproate belongs to a group of medicines called antiepileptics (medicines used to prevent and control seizures). It works by increasing the activity of gamma-aminobutyric acid (GABA) (a natural chemical in the brain that helps calm nerve cells and reduce excessive electrical activity). It also helps regulate the movement of sodium channels (pathways that allow electrical signals to travel between nerve cells), making overactive nerve cells less likely to fire repeatedly. Together, these actions help stabilise electrical activity in the brain, reducing the likelihood of seizures.

What if I have taken an overdose of Valpro Injection 5 ml

Since this medicine is given by medical professionals, an overdose is highly unlikely. However, if you suspect you have received too much or experience severe sleepiness, shallow breathing, or confusion, tell your healthcare provider or seek emergency medical help immediately.

Drug Warnings

  • Inspect the vial before use: Always check the injection liquid before it is given. Do not use it if you see particles, cloudiness, or any discolouration.
  • Monitor your liver function: Your doctor will need to perform regular blood tests to check your liver health, especially during the first six months of treatment.
  • Use effective birth control: This medicine can cause severe birth defects. If you are a female of childbearing age, discuss highly effective birth control options with your doctor.
  • Do not stop treatment suddenly: Stopping this medicine abruptly can cause your seizures to return or become more severe. Always consult your doctor before making any changes.
  • Avoid driving or operating machinery: This medicine can make you feel dizzy or sleepy. Do not perform tasks that require focus until you know how it affects you.
  • Pregnancy and contraception: If you can become pregnant, use effective contraception while receiving this medicine. Your doctor should review your treatment and contraception at least once a year. Consult your doctor right away if you are pregnant, think you may be pregnant, or plan to become pregnant. Do not stop this medicine without medical advice.

  • Other anti-seizure medicines (such as carbamazepine, phenytoin, phenobarbital, lamotrigine, or topiramate): May affect sodium valproate levels or increase the risk of side effects. Your doctor may need to adjust your treatment.
  • Carbapenem antibiotics (such as meropenem, imipenem, or ertapenem): May greatly reduce sodium valproate levels, making it less effective at preventing seizures. This combination is generally avoided whenever possible.
  • Blood thinners (such as warfarin): May increase the risk of bleeding.
  • Aspirin: May increase sodium valproate levels and the risk of side effects, particularly in children.
  • Medicines that cause drowsiness (such as sleeping tablets, opioid pain medicines, or some anti-anxiety medicines): May increase drowsiness and reduce alertness.

Valpro Injection 5 ml belongs to the group of medicines called anticonvulsants or anti-epileptics used to treat epilepsy/seizures/fits. Additionally, it is also used to treat bipolar disorder.
Valpro Injection 5 ml decreases the excessive and abnormal nerve activity in the brain. It balances the brain's chemical messenger and prevents overactivity of the brain, thereby controlling seizure episodes.
Valpro Injection 5 ml may cause weight gain due to an increase in appetite. Maintain a healthy weight by following a proper diet and exercising regularly.
Valpro Injection 5 ml may cause hepatotoxicity (liver damage). Consult your doctor if you experience symptoms such as weakness, facial swelling, vomiting, malaise (general discomfort), lethargy (lack of energy or enthusiasm), and anorexia (eating disorder). Serum liver tests before starting Valpro Injection 5 ml and at regular intervals for at least six months are advised.
Valpro Injection 5 ml should not be administered to women of childbearing age unless it is essential to manage their condition. Women of child-bearing age must use effective contraception whilst on treatment with Valpro Injection 5 ml.
Valpro Injection 5 ml may cause side effects, such as sleepiness, weakness, dizziness, nausea, and headache. Talk to your doctor if you experience these side effects persistently.
No, Valpro Injection 5 ml injection is a parenteral medication that must be prepared and given by a trained healthcare professional in a clinic or hospital setting to monitor your safety. Talk to your doctor if you have questions about where you will receive your treatment.
This medicine can cause severe birth defects and developmental problems in unborn babies. It should only be used during pregnancy if there is no other safe option. Talk to your doctor immediately if you are pregnant or planning to become pregnant.
Dizziness is a common side effect of this medicine. Rest quietly, avoid standing up too quickly, and do not drive or use machinery until the feeling passes. Talk to your doctor if your dizziness is severe or does not go away.
You should avoid alcohol while receiving this medicine. Alcohol can increase side effects like severe drowsiness and can also increase your risk of having a seizure. Talk to your doctor for advice on lifestyle habits.
Blood tests are essential to monitor your liver function, blood clotting cells, and the level of the medicine in your body to ensure the treatment is both safe and effective. Talk to your doctor about your schedule for blood tests.
